The Music Industry – Contextual Research
1. It is the duty of the record label to promote the video and the band, so the final decision lies with them. Large companies will be able to organise a wide variety of marketing techniques such as a point of sale is a store such as HMV. Also if the budget is big enough then a TV or radio advert can be a very effective marketing tool. It is usually the case that a record label will have an in-house marketing team but small companies sometimes will employ a small advertising team for the specific job.
2. A music video is a vital piece of marketing for the band. It is a visual representation of the bands style and “meta narrative”. Music videos are seen by an extremely large audience and are an opportunity to be eye catching and memorable to stay in the viewer’s mind. If the director of the video decides to break the rules and conventions of the genre then the video can become controversial which is memorable and is good publicity for the band or artist.
3. The process of making a music video is very similar to making a film opening. The first step after you have all your equipment is to plan your shoot. This involves drawing a storyboard and making a list of all the props that are needed. Then it’s the actually filming. When the director has all of the necessary shots then it’s the editor’s job to piece them together.
